Colby Barnett’s sixth-minute goal held up as the winner for AFC Toronto in a 1-0 win over Halifax Tides FC on Saturday in the Northern Super League.

An unmarked Barnett calmly slotted a volley past Tides ‘keeper Erin McLeod after a high cross from Nikayla Small to give Toronto (2-2-1) the early lead at Wanderers Grounds.

“Nikki put in the most perfect ball that she could have. In my mind I was just like, `Do not miss this, do not miss this,'” said Barnett, who scored her first NSL goal. “I was really happy to be on the other side and it definitely feels nice. I get why the strikers like it so much.”
